Publisher's summary

The year is A.D. 922. A refined Arab courtier, representative of the powerful Caliph of Baghdad, encounters a party of Viking warriors who are journeying to the barbaric North. He is appalled by their Viking customs - the wanton sexuality of their pale, angular women, their disregard for cleanliness...their cold-blooded human sacrifices. But it is not until they reach the depths of the Northland that the courtier learns the horrifying and inescapable truth: he has been enlisted by these savage, inscrutable warriors to help combat a terror that plagues them - a monstrosity that emerges under cover of night to slaughter the Vikings and devour their flesh....

Eaters of the Dead was adapted to the screen as The 13th Warrior, starring Antonio Banderas.

Brilliant

I wasn't sure at first that I would like the "journal" style of this book, but I soon realized that it was perfect and creative way for Crichton to present the story, especially since the opening chapters are a re-working of an actual historic journal. Simon Vance, as always, did a wonderful job.

Not his best work

An OK listen. Nothing earth-shattering.

The story is told like a Koran reading, very declarative and droll. Crichton's faux academic investigation, (whether false or not) is not very convincing. He's either genuinely making a case for Neanderthal late existence or he is faking it. Either way it feels fraudulent, Piltdown man-like.

Nonetheless the cover has the author's name in bigger letters than the title of the book, so we all know it must be good right?
